44 Leeward Gardens

    44, LEEWARD GARDENS, LONDON, SW19 7QR

    This terraced freehold property on Leeward Gardens last sold in June 2018 for £1,200,000. Based on price growth in the SW19 district since then, its estimated current value is £1,371,084 — placing it in the 98th percentile nationally and the 84th percentile within SW19. The property covers 150 m² (1,615 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£9,141 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of B.
